Why this rating

This daycare earned 4 out of 5 stars overall. Structural quality reflects Colorado's licensing baseline. Colorado caps infant ratios at 1:5, toddler ratios at 1:5, and preschool ratios at 1:12. Lead teachers must hold a High School Diploma. Teachers must complete 15 hours of annual training. No objective process measures (e.g., state quality rating or national accreditation) are available for this daycare. The overall rating reflects structural features only.

Inspection History

3 Inspection Visits Since 2024 · 3 Findings · 0% Corrected at Visit
3 Important

Across 3 inspections since 2024, the issues cited most often were Emergency Preparedness & Drills (1), Children's Records & Files (1), and Staff Qualifications & Background Checks (1). None of the 3 findings were critical.

See All 3 Inspection Visits
  1. Feb 19, 20261 Finding1 Important
    • All Child Care Providers Must Have a Written Plan For: Evacuating and Safely Moving Children to an Alternate Site; Lockdown; Shelter in Place; And an Active Shooter on Premises.…2.134.A

      Director completed training on provider's written emergency plans on 11/24/24. Observed no evidence of Director renewing this training annually.

  2. Nov 22, 20241 Finding1 Important
    • Television Viewing, Including Videos, Should Not Be Permitted Without the Approval of a Child's Parent(s) or Guardian(s), Who Must Be Advised of the Center's Policy Regarding…2.519.A

      Reviewed children's enrollment form. Observed no evidence of parent authorization approving television and video viewing.

  3. Jan 4, 20241 Finding1 Important
    • The Center Office Must Maintain a Record for Each Staff Member That Includes The: Verification of the Staff Member's Certifications, Qualifications and Training Requirements;2.526.A.4

      No evidence of director qualifications in F.M.C.'s file. This is a repeat violation from 11/2/23 Follow Up inspection. Identified provider submitted a waiver request pertaining to director not having evidence of verification of experience working with school aged children. Identified the appeal panel meeting date is scheduled for 1/8/24.
